Solution

The correct option is D (x2+8x+12)cm2
Given: l=(x+2)cmb=(x+6)cm
Area of a rectangle = length × breadth
Area=(x+2)(x+6)=x(x+6)+2(x+6)=x2+6x+2x+2×6=(x2+8x+12)cm2
